RECORD: Rec_0300426 VERIFIED: YES
Provenance & Taxonomy
Bacillus polymyxa [Bacterium]
Structure & Mods
head-to-tail cyclic peptide [Cyclic]
mixed L/D amino-acid peptide [Mixed]
Lipidation
Esterification
The carboxylic end of Ala6 forms an ester bond with the hydroxyl group of T1. Val2, Gln5, Ala6 are D-amino acids and Thr4 is a D-allo-Thr. In addition, the N-terminus NH is lipidated with 15-guanidino-3-hydroxypentadecanoic acid (GHPD). Refer to the article for additional physical properties
Bio-Activity Profile
Antimicrobial Antifungal
Candida albicans IFO 1594, S. cerevisiae HUT 7099
12.5 μg/mL
MIC
